Understanding Limo Service Pricing in Bergen County

Most people find limo pricing confusing because it’s not a metered rate. In Ramsey, you’ll typically run into two models:

  • Flat Rates: Standard for airport runs to EWR, JFK, or LGA. You pay one set price regardless of the route.
    • Pro Tip: This protects you from “traffic bleeding.” If the GWB is a parking lot, your price doesn’t move.
  • Hourly Minimums: Used for nights out at Varka or local weddings. Most Bergen County services have a 3-hour minimum.
    • Insider Detail: Ask about “Door-to-Door” billing. Local Ramsey services shouldn’t charge you for the time it takes to drive from their office to your house. The clock should only start when they arrive at your door.

The “All-In” Rule: Always ask for the “Out the Door” price. A professional quote should already include tolls and the standard 20% service fee (the driver’s tip). If a company gives you a “base rate” that sounds too good to be true, they are probably going to hit you with fuel surcharges and “admin fees” later.

Choosing Your Ride: The Right Vehicle for Every Scenario

In Ramsey, choosing the right vehicle is about more than just the number of seats. It is about matching the car to the “vibe” and logistics of your day. We do not just tell you what we have; we help you pick the best tool for the job.

 

The Corporate Standard: SUV and Suburban

When you need to get to a meeting in the city or a flight at EWR, these are the workhorses of the fleet.

  • Best for: 1 to 6 passengers.
  • The Scenario: You are heading to a morning flight with the family or a business partner. You need a professional car that handles Route 17 with ease and has enough trunk space for four large suitcases without feeling cramped.
  • The Difference: While a standard SUV is great, the Suburban offers that extra “L” (long) frame, ensuring that even with a full house, your luggage is not sitting on your lap.

The Executive Statement: Cadillac Escalade

Sometimes, “standard” isn’t enough. The Escalade is for when the impression you make is just as important as the ride itself.

  • Best for: 1 to 6 passengers.
  • The Scenario: Picking up a high-priority client from the airport or heading to a black-tie gala. It provides a commanding presence and a level of interior luxury, think cooled seats and premium sound that a standard SUV cannot match.

The Classic Celebration: Stretch Limo

There is nothing quite like the silhouette of a stretch limousine for life’s biggest milestones.

  • Best for: 6 to 10 passengers.
  • The Scenario: Prom night, a romantic anniversary dinner, or a small bridal party heading to the church. It is built for photos, shared toasts, and that classic “VIP” feeling you only get when the long door opens.

The Group Logistics: Sprinter Van

If you have a medium-sized group and want to travel comfortably without everyone being squished, this is the modern favourite.

  • Best for: 10 to 14 passengers.
  • The Scenario: A group of friends heading to a Giants game at MetLife or a Broadway show. Unlike a limo, you can stand up in a Sprinter, making it much easier to get in and out for multiple stops. It is the king of “managed travel” for groups.

The Mobile Event: Party Bus

When the travel itself is the party, you need the space and energy of a bus.

  • Best for: 15 to 30+ passengers.
  • The Scenario: Bachelor or bachelorette parties, milestone birthdays, or large-scale wedding shuttles. With perimeter seating, high-end lighting, and massive sound systems, the celebration starts the second you leave your driveway in Ramsey.

The “Don’t Get Stranded” Checklist: Questions to Ask Before You Book

Booking a ride in Bergen County shouldn’t feel like a gamble. If a company can’t give you a straight answer to these, they probably aren’t the right fit for your trip. Use this list to vet any service before you hand over your credit card.

The Fleet and Safety Basics

  • Do you actually own this vehicle?

Many sites are just “middle-man” brokers. They take your money and then outsource the ride to whoever is cheapest. You want a company that owns its cars and employs its drivers.

  • Is the driver a dedicated employee or a gig worker? 

You are paying for a professional chauffeur, not a random person with a clean car. Ask if they are background-checked and drug-tested.

  • Can I get a specific confirmation of the vehicle’s year and model? 

Don’t pay “New Escalade” prices only to have a 10-year-old SUV with 200k miles show up in your driveway.

Airport and Timing Logistics

  • How do you track my flight if it’s delayed (or early)? 

A pro service tracks your tail number. They should be there when you land, whether it’s 2:00 PM or 2:00 AM, without you having to call them from the tarmac.

  • What is your ‘Wait Time’ policy? 

Life happens. Bags get lost. Ask how many minutes of “grace time” you get after your flight lands before they start charging extra.

  • Are tolls and tips already in this quote? 

In 2026, “hidden fees” are a huge red flag. Your quote should be the “out the door” price. If it’s not, ask for a breakdown of the service fee and fuel surcharges.

The Family and Comfort Factors

  • Are the car seats pre-installed by the driver? 

If a service tells you, “We have them in the trunk for you to install,” keep looking. A high-end Ramsey service has the seat ready and waiting, so you can just clip the kids in and go.

  • What is your cancellation window? 

Meetings get moved, and kids get sick. Know exactly how much notice you need to give to get a full refund.

  • Does the driver have a local backup contact? 

If there’s a flat tire on the Garden State Parkway, you need to know there’s a dispatcher back at the office who can send a second car immediately.
